Caorle is a small seaside resort in Veneto: the fine sand, clear waters and tourist attractions make this small seaside town a real Italian jewel. So, let’s see together how to spend your holidays in the best way possible!
Caorle is a small city of Roman origins just an hour from Venice: a very popular tourist destination, today it retains the charm of a small and characteristic seaside village. Among the most beautiful places to visit there is certainly the historic centre with the Piazza Vescovado, the Cathedral dating back to 1038 and its cylindrical bell tower as well as the Sanctuary of the Madonna dell’Angelo.
